CS2 an RSK Group company are recruiting for a Graduate Building Surveyor to join the team based in Northampton, UK. This is a full-time, permanent position.

In July 2021 CS2 was acquired by the RSK Group of Companies.  RSK’s culture is very similar to that of CS2 and there are many synergies with our mutual guiding principle.

Responsibilities:

  • Conducting building surveys and inspections.
  • Assisting in the preparation of schedules of condition and dilapidations reports.
  • Providing support to senior surveyors in project management and contract administration.
  • Undertaking building pathology and defect analysis.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• A bachelor’s degree in building surveying or a related field.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• A keen eye for detail and the ability to work both independently and as part of a team.
  • A desire to learn and develop within the building surveying profession.

We are building surveying and cost consultancy experts providing a full range of multi-disciplinary property and construction services for all market sectors across the UK and Europe. Our services include construction consultancy, building surveying, dilapidations, cost consultancy, and energy and sustainability consultancy. From industrial and defence to retail and residential, our experts endeavour to find the best solutions: long-term, cost-effective and strategic.
